9-Year-Old In Critical Condition, Reportedly Lit Herself On Fire Inside Brooklyn Charter School

NEW YORK (CBSNewYork) – A nine-year-old girl is in critical condition after being badly burned inside a Brooklyn charter school.

Sources tell CBS2 the young girl was found inside a bathroom at Excellence Girls Academy Charter School in Stuyvesant Heights around 2:30 p.m.

First responders say the nine-year-old has 2nd degree and 3rd degree burns to her chest, neck, stomach and arms.

Investigators believe the student may have accidentally lit her school uniform on fire after finding a lighter in the bathroom. A teacher across the hall heard her screaming. When she entered the bathroom, smoke was pouring out of the girl's stall.

The girl has been rushed to New York's Cornell Burn Center.
